§ 4157a. Temporary licensure

An applicant who is currently certified by and in good standing with the National Athletic Trainers Association Board of Certification, or who is currently licensed or certified and in good standing in another state, shall be eligible for a 60-day temporary license. Applicants under this section shall meet the requirements of section 4158 of this title. Temporary practice shall not exceed 60 days in any calendar year. (Added 1999, No. 133 (Adj. Sess.), § 32; amended 2003, No. 60, § 29.)
